Abstract

The invention discloses a direct insertion type beach volleyball post assembly. In the Direct insertion type beach volleyball post assembly, a primary pulley (5) and a net rope tightening device are arranged on the top of and in a primary net post (1) respectively; a secondary pulley (6) and a hook assembly are arranged on the top of and in a secondary net post (2) respectively; an upper net rope I (7) and a lower net rope I (8), which are positioned on one side of a volleyball net (3), are connected with the net rope tightening device and a hook I (9) respectively; an upper net rope II (10) and a lower net rope II (11), which are positioned on the other side of the volleyball net (3), are connected with the upper and lower part of the hook assembly respectively; a primary lining pipe (12) at the bottom of the primary net post (1) is inserted into an embedded part (4); a secondary lining pipe (13) at the bottom of the secondary net post (2) is inserted into another embedded part (4); net post lifting devices are arranged in both the primary lining pipe (12) and the secondary lining pipe (13); screw devices are fixed on the inner walls of the primary lining pipe (12) and the secondary lining pipe (13) respectively; and locking devices are arranged on the side faces of the two embedded parts (4).

Description

A kind of direct insertion beach volleyball column combination
Technical field
The present invention relates to a kind of direct insertion beach volleyball column combination.
Background technology
It is that volleyball post directly is inserted in the base that present beach volleyball post adopts, and then pulls out post and inserting column by manual, brings a lot of inconvenience so when mounted, and the accuracy of height can not get ensureing.
Summary of the invention
The invention provides a kind of direct insertion beach volleyball column combination, it not only is convenient to install and uses, and the accuracy height of lifting, the stablizing of installation.
The present invention has adopted following technical scheme: a kind of direct insertion beach volleyball column combination, it comprises major network post and secondary net post, between major network post and secondary net post, be provided with volleyball net, bottom at major network post and secondary net post all is provided with built-in fitting, the bottom of built-in fitting is provided with bracing or strutting arrangement, the top of described major network post is provided with head pulley, in the major network post, be provided with the nettle tightening device, top at secondary net post is provided with auxiliary pulley, in secondary net post, be provided with the hook combination, the upper and lower of volleyball net one side is respectively equipped with nettle I and following nettle I, the major network post is inner to be connected with the nettle tightening device last nettle I through extending into behind the head pulley, following nettle I extend into major network post hook I inner and in the major network post and is connected, be respectively equipped with nettle II and following nettle II in the upper and lower of volleyball net opposite side, secondary net post is inner to be connected with the hook groups portion of closing last nettle II through extending into behind the auxiliary pulley, following nettle II extend into secondary net post inside and is connected with hook combination bottom, be set to main bushing pipe and secondary bushing pipe respectively in the bottom of major network post and secondary net post, main bushing pipe is inserted in the built-in fitting of major network column bottom, secondary bushing pipe is inserted in the built-in fitting of secondary net post bottom, in main bushing pipe and secondary bushing pipe, all be provided with the net post lowering or hoisting gear, on the inwall of main bushing pipe and secondary bushing pipe, be fixed with screw respectively, each net post lowering or hoisting gear and screw are in transmission connection, net post lowering or hoisting gear in the main bushing pipe drives on the major network post by screw, move down, net post lowering or hoisting gear in the secondary bushing pipe drives on the secondary net post by screw, move down, be provided with locking device in the side of two built-in fittings.
Described nettle tightening device is provided with worm and worm wheel, the end of worm screw is set to screw thread and becomes the perpendicular shape engagement with worm gear, the other end of worm screw stretches out the major network post and is connected with crank, is with coaxial lanyard wheel in the side of worm gear, last nettle I through behind the head pulley around the home on lanyard is taken turns.
Described hook combination comprises that upper wire hook and lower clasp, upper wire hook and lower clasp are fixed in the secondary net post, and last nettle II is connected with the upper wire hook through behind the auxiliary pulley, and following nettle II is connected with lower clasp.Described bracing or strutting arrangement is provided with bracing frame and ballast box, and three support bars that bracing frame is provided with are " T " font arranges, and three support bars of bracing frame and ballast box are located at the four direction of built-in fitting bottom.
Net post lowering or hoisting gear in the described main bushing pipe comprises the driving bevel gear I of horizontally set and the leading screw I that vertically is provided with, be provided with driven bevel pinion I on the top of leading screw I, the side of driving bevel gear I is provided with handle I, driving bevel gear I and driven bevel pinion I are Vertical Meshing, the side of described main bushing pipe is provided with bearing arrangement I, fixing screw is set to flat thread cover I on the main bushing pipe inwall, leading screw I inserts in the flat thread cover I, the external screw thread of leading screw I matches with the internal thread of flat thread cover I, driving bevel gear I drives leading screw I by driven bevel pinion I and rotates in flat thread cover I, flat thread cover I drove on the main bushing pipe of major network post when leading screw I rotated at flat thread cover I, following lifting moving, thereby promote on the major network post, following lifting moving, the locking device that is positioned at the built-in fitting side of major network column bottom is set to lock screw I, after the lifting of major network post puts in place, after tightening lock screw I and main bushing pipe pushing up mutually with major network post locking positioning, when the major network post need be regulated, unclamp lock screw I with on the major network post, following lifting moving is regulated.
Net post lowering or hoisting gear in the described secondary bushing pipe comprises the driving bevel gear II of horizontally set and the leading screw II that vertically is provided with, be provided with driven bevel pinion II on the top of leading screw II, the side of driving bevel gear II is provided with handle II, driving bevel gear II and driven bevel pinion II are Vertical Meshing, the side of described secondary bushing pipe is provided with bearing arrangement II, fixing screw is set to flat thread cover II on the secondary bushing pipe inwall, leading screw II inserts in the flat thread cover II, the external screw thread of leading screw II matches with the internal thread of flat thread cover II, driving bevel gear II drives leading screw II by driven bevel pinion II and rotates in flat thread cover II, flat thread cover II drove on the secondary bushing pipe of secondary net post when leading screw II rotated at flat thread cover II, move down, thereby promote on the secondary net post, move down, the locking device that is positioned at the built-in fitting side of secondary net post bottom is set to lock screw II, after secondary net post lifting puts in place, after tightening lock screw II and secondary bushing pipe pushing up mutually with secondary net post locking positioning, when secondary net post need be regulated, unclamp lock screw II with on the secondary net post, following lifting moving is regulated.The outside of described major network post is provided with sheath.The outside of described secondary net post is provided with sheath.
The present invention has following beneficial effect: the present invention is provided with the nettle tightening device, can easily and efficiently volleyball net be tightened up like this, avoid occurring the volleyball net both sides reel not tight, the carrying out of influence match.The present invention is provided with built-in fitting in the bottom of major network post and secondary net post, the bottom of built-in fitting is provided with bracing or strutting arrangement, bracing or strutting arrangement is provided with bracing frame and ballast box, three support bars that bracing frame is provided with are " T " font arranges, and the four direction that three support bars of bracing frame and ballast box are located at the built-in fitting bottom can make major network post and secondary net post support steadily like this.The present invention is provided with the net post lowering or hoisting gear in the bushing pipe of main grid structure and secondary rack, can avoid utilizing manual pull out post and inserting column like this, not only install and easy to adjust, and the ratio of precision of regulating is higher, simultaneously stable relatively good after the adjusting.
